[libc++] Add tag types to all the __tuple_impl constructors (#154517)

This fixes a bug reported in
https://github.com/llvm/llvm-project/pull/151654#issuecomment-3205410955.

GitOrigin-RevId: d9a192cd6bd33a0de2d923bb5215564fcffe9d7c
2 files changed